Gallipolis, Ohio, has a rich history dating back to the late 18th century, when it was founded as a French colonial outpost. The town's early settlers were primarily of European descent, with many families tracing their roots back to France, Germany, and Ireland. Throughout its history, Gallipolis has been shaped by the people who have called it home, from farmers and craftsmen to entrepreneurs and community leaders. The town's obituaries reflect this diversity, with many individuals' stories reflecting the town's cultural heritage.
